V tomto článku sa naučíme, ako zosumarizovať vrchné alebo spodné hodnoty N pre dané číslo v programe Excel. Ak chcete sčítať top 4, top 5 alebo top N hodnôt v danom rozsahu, pomôže vám to tento článok.
Súčet TOP N hodnôt
V tomto článku budeme musieť používať funkciu SUMPRODUCT. Teraz z týchto funkcií vytvoríme vzorec. Tu dostaneme rozsah a musíme top 5 hodnôt v rozsahu a získať súčet hodnôt.
Všeobecný vzorec:
= SUMPRODUCT (VEĽKÝ (rozsah, {1, 2,…., N}})
rozsah: rozsah hodnôt
Hodnoty: čísla oddelené čiarkami. Ak chcete nájsť prvé tri hodnoty, použite {1, 2, 3}.
Príklad: Suma Top 5 hodnôt rozsahu
Otestujme tento vzorec spustením na príklade uvedenom nižšie.
Tu máme rozsah hodnôt od A1: A23.
Rozsah A1: A23 obsahuje hodnoty a je pomenovaný ako hodnoty.
Po prvé, musíme nájsť prvých päť hodnôt pomocou funkcie LARGE a potom vykonať súčet operácií pre týchto 5 hodnôt. Teraz použijeme nasledujúci vzorec na získanie súčtu prvých 5 hodnôt.
Použite vzorec:
= SUMPRODUCT (VEĽKÝ (rozsah, {1, 2, 3, 4, 5}))
Vysvetlenie:
- Funkcia LARGE vracia prvých 5 číselných hodnôt a vracia pole do funkcie SUMPRODUCT.
= SUMPRODUCT ({149, 123, 100, 87, 85}))
- Funkcia SUMPRODUCT získava súhrn 5 najlepších hodnôt.
Tu je rozsah uvedený ako pomenovaný rozsah. Stlačením klávesu Enter získate SÚČET 5 najlepších čísel.
Ako vidíte na vyššie uvedenom obrázku, tento súčet je 544. Súčet hodnôt 149 + 123 + 100 + 87 + 85 = 544.
Vyššie uvedený postup sa používa na výpočet súčtu niekoľkých čísel zhora. Ale počítať pre n (veľký) počet hodnôt v dlhom rozsahu.
Použite vzorec:
= SUMPRODUCT (VEĽKÝ (rozsah, RIADOK (NEPRIAMY ("1:10"))
Tu generujeme súčet 10 najlepších hodnôt získaním poľa od 1 do 10 {1; 2; 3; 4; 5; 6; 7; 8; 9; 10} pomocou funkcií ROW & INDIRECT Excel.
Tu sme dostali súčet 10 najlepších čísel {149; 123; 100; 87; 85; 82; 61; 58; 54; 51}), čo má za následok 850.
Súčet dolných hodnôt N.
Ako problém vyriešiť?
Všeobecný vzorec:
= SUMPRODUCT (MALÝ (rozsah, {1, 2,…., N}})
Rozsah: rozsah hodnôt
Hodnoty: čísla oddelené čiarkami, napríklad ak chcete nájsť 3 najnižšie hodnoty, použite {1, 2, 3}.
Príklad:
Toto všetko môže byť mätúce na pochopenie. Otestujme teda tento vzorec spustením na príklade uvedenom nižšie.
Tu máme rozsah hodnôt od A1: A23.
Tu je rozsah, ktorý je daný pomocou pomenovaného nástroja Excel.
Po prvé, musíme nájsť päť najnižších hodnôt pomocou funkcie SMALL a potom vykonať súhrnnú operáciu pre týchto 5 hodnôt. Teraz použijeme nasledujúci vzorec na získanie súčtu
Použite vzorec:
= SUMPRODUCT (MALÝ (rozsah, {1, 2, 3, 4, 5}))
Vysvetlenie:
- Funkcia SMALL vracia spodných 5 číselných hodnôt a vracia pole do funkcie SUMPRODUCT.
= SUMPRODUCT ({23, 27, 28, 28, 30}))
- Funkcia SUMPRODUCT získava množstvo spodných 5 hodnôt, ktoré je potrebné zhrnúť.
Tu je rozsah uvedený ako pomenovaný rozsah. Stlačením klávesu Enter získate SÚČET spodných 5 čísel.
Ako vidíte na vyššie uvedenom obrázku, tento súčet je 136. Súčet hodnôt 23 + 27 + 28 + 28 + 30 = 136.
Vyššie uvedený postup sa používa na výpočet súčtu niekoľkých čísel zospodu. Ale počítať pre n (veľký) počet hodnôt v dlhom rozsahu.
Použite vzorec:
= SUMPRODUCT (MALÝ (rozsah, RIADOK (NEPRIAMY ("1:10"))
Tu generujeme súčet najnižších hodnôt 10 získaním poľa od 1 do 10 {1; 2; 3; 4; 5; 6; 7; 8; 9; 10} pomocou funkcií ROW & INDIRECT Excel.
Tu máme súčet spodných 10 čísel, ktorých výsledkom bude 307.
Tu je niekoľko pozorovacích poznámok uvedených nižšie.
Poznámky:
- Vzorec funguje iba s číslami.
- Vzorec funguje iba vtedy, ak vo vyhľadávacej tabuľke nie sú žiadne duplikáty
- Funkcia SUMPRODUCT považuje nečíselné hodnoty (ako text abc) a chybové hodnoty (ako #ČÍSLO!, #NULL!) Za nulové hodnoty.
- Funkcia SUMPRODUCT považuje logickú hodnotu TRUE za 1 a False za 0.
- Pole argumentov musí mať rovnakú dĺžku ako funkcia.
Dúfam, že tento článok o tom, ako vrátiť súčet vrchných n hodnôt alebo dolných n hodnôt v programe Excel, je vysvetľujúci. Tu nájdete ďalšie články o funkciách SUMPRODUCT. Podeľte sa o svoj dotaz nižšie v poli pre komentáre. Pomôžeme vám.
Ako používať funkciu SUMPRODUCT v programe Excel: Vráti SUMU po vynásobení hodnôt vo viacerých poliach v programe Excel.
SUM, ak je dátum medzi : Vráti SÚčet hodnôt medzi danými dátumami alebo obdobím v programe Excel.
Suma, ak je dátum väčší ako daný dátum: Vráti SÚčet hodnôt po danom dátume alebo období v programe Excel.
2 spôsoby súčtu podľa mesiacov v programe Excel: Vráti SÚčet hodnôt v rámci daného konkrétneho mesiaca v programe Excel.
Ako sčítať viac stĺpcov s podmienkou: Vráti SÚčet hodnôt vo viacerých stĺpcoch s podmienkou v programe Excel
Ako používať zástupné znaky v programe Excel : Spočítajte bunky zodpovedajúce frázam pomocou zástupných znakov v programe Excel
Populárne články
50 Skratka pre Excel, ktorá zvýši vašu produktivitu
Upravte rozbaľovací zoznam
Absolútna referencia v Exceli
Ak s podmieneným formátovaním
Ak so zástupnými znakmi
Vlookup podľa dátumu
V programe Excel 2016 preveďte palce na nohy a palce
Pripojte meno a priezvisko v Exceli
Spočítajte bunky, ktoré sa zhodujú s A alebo B